What is spatial visualization ability?
Spatial visualization ability refers to the capacity to mentally manipulate and comprehend spatial relationships between objects. Individuals with strong spatial visualization skills can easily visualize and understand how objects relate to each other in space, such as rotating or manipulating shapes in their mind. This ability is crucial in various fields such as engineering, architecture, and mathematics, as it allows individuals to solve complex problems and understand spatial concepts more effectively. Improving spatial visualization ability can enhance problem-solving skills and overall cognitive performance. **
Is spatial visualization important for engineers?
Yes, spatial visualization is important for engineers as it allows them to mentally manipulate and understand complex 3D objects and structures. Engineers often need to design and analyze various components and systems, and spatial visualization skills help them to conceptualize and communicate their ideas effectively. Whether it's designing a new product, creating blueprints for a building, or solving complex problems, spatial visualization is a crucial skill that allows engineers to think critically and innovate in their field. **

What are problems with spatial visualization skills?
Some problems with spatial visualization skills include difficulty in understanding and interpreting maps, graphs, and diagrams. Individuals with poor spatial visualization skills may struggle with tasks such as navigating through unfamiliar environments, understanding 3D objects, and mentally rotating objects. This can impact their performance in subjects such as math, science, and engineering, as well as in everyday activities such as driving and assembling furniture. Additionally, poor spatial visualization skills can lead to frustration and decreased confidence in one's abilities. **

Can one improve their spatial visualization skills?
Yes, it is possible to improve spatial visualization skills through practice and training. Engaging in activities such as puzzles, building models, and playing spatial reasoning games can help develop these skills. Additionally, practicing mental rotation exercises and regularly challenging oneself with spatial tasks can also contribute to improvement. With consistent effort and dedication, individuals can enhance their spatial visualization abilities over time. **

What is the spatial representation of the wedge-dash formula?
The wedge-dash formula is a spatial representation of a molecule's three-dimensional structure. In this representation, solid wedges are used to indicate bonds that project out of the plane of the paper, while dashed lines are used to indicate bonds that project behind the plane of the paper. This allows for a clear depiction of the molecule's stereochemistry, showing the relative positions of atoms and groups in three-dimensional space. The wedge-dash formula is particularly useful for understanding the arrangement of atoms around chiral centers and for visualizing the molecule's overall shape. **

What does it mean if someone lacks spatial visualization skills?
If someone lacks spatial visualization skills, it means that they have difficulty mentally manipulating and understanding spatial relationships between objects and shapes. This can manifest as challenges in tasks such as reading maps, understanding 3D objects, or visualizing how objects fit together in space. People with this difficulty may struggle with activities such as assembling furniture, reading graphs, or understanding geometric concepts. It's important to note that lacking spatial visualization skills does not indicate a lack of intelligence, but rather a specific cognitive challenge in this area. **
What is the difference between empirical formula, molecular formula, and structural formula?
The empirical formula represents the simplest whole number ratio of atoms in a compound. The molecular formula gives the actual number of each type of atom in a molecule. The structural formula shows the arrangement of atoms in a molecule, including the bonds between them. In summary, the empirical formula is the simplest representation, the molecular formula gives the actual number of atoms, and the structural formula provides a detailed depiction of the molecule's structure. **
